Wingstop Was America’s Fastest-Growing Restaurant Chain in 2025

Wingstop opened more U.S. restaurants in 2025 than any other quick-service franchise brand in the country, according to a preview of QSR Magazine’s annual QSR 50 ranking. The Dallas-based chicken wing chain posted 382 net new domestic locations during the year, finishing with 2,586 U.S. restaurants and 3,056 units worldwide as it accelerates toward a long-term goal of 10,000 stores.

The chain’s 2025 expansion outpaced second-place Chipotle by nearly 100 locations. Wingstop recorded 384 gross openings against just four closures, a closure rate that has been near zero for three consecutive years. System-wide sales reached $5.3 billion, and average unit volumes came in at $2.02 million for stores that operated the full year. With around 98% of its restaurants operated by franchisees, Wingstop’s franchise model continues to drive its rapid expansion across the U.S. and international markets.

Wingstop’s 384 gross openings in 2025 followed lifts of 278 and 205 in 2024 and 2023 respectively, marking a clear acceleration in its development pace. The brand did not terminate a single franchise unit during the year, and has ceased operations at just five total locations since 2023. Over that three-year span, it opened 868 franchised restaurants while closing five. California and Texas remain the two largest markets, with 457 and 428 units respectively at year-end 2025.

The top five quick-service brands by net domestic unit growth in 2025 were as follows, according to QSR Magazine:

  • Wingstop : +382 net new U.S. locations
  • Chipotle : +294
  • 7 Brew : +281
  • Jersey Mike’s : +238
  • Dunkin’ : +231

Wingstop’s 2025 unit expansion coincided with a more challenging sales environment at the store level. Same-store sales turned negative for the first time in 22 years, declining 3.3% for the full year and 5.8% in the fourth quarter. The brand attributed the softness to macro pressures, including a pullback among lower-income consumers who represent approximately 25% of its customer base. Average unit volumes, which stood at $2.02 million in 2025, declined modestly from the $2.1 million recorded in 2024. Median annual net sales across the network reached $1.904 million.

Good to know

Wingstop’s upfront investment to build a new location runs approximately $580,000. According to the company, most franchisees have historically reached payback periods of less than two years, based on the brand’s stated AUV trajectory. Individual results vary by market and operator.

Wingstop entered 2026 with 378 new franchise openings scheduled and more than 2,200 restaurant commitments under development agreements. In the first quarter of 2026, the brand added a net 97 units globally, reaching 3,153 total locations. Domestic same-store sales slipped further to -8.7% in that quarter, affected by weather-related closures at more than 700 units and continued pressure on traffic. The company guided for low single-digit same-store sales growth for the full year of 2026, with a return to positive territory targeted in the second half. Q2 2026 results are scheduled for release on July 29, 2026.

The brand’s long-range ambition is to reach 10,000 stores globally, which would rank it among the top 10 restaurant chains worldwide. As of year-end 2025, Wingstop was No. 15 by U.S. system-wide sales at $5.34 billion, placing it just behind Raising Cane’s and ahead of its own 2024 position.
